I wanted something on my desk to look at from time to time to take me out of the work zone and into a short break. A beta fish seemed to be a popular choice of some coworkers, but I didn't want anything truly "alive" because I'm often away from the office for days. I saw this jellyfish at Best Buy and thought, why not? It's really neat! It'll be "sleeping" then sense my movement then it comes alive slowly with its lights on and twirls in the water. It's whimsical, and I'm glad I purchased it!
